So what exactly happens after one year of eating tomatoes every day?
Here are the findings that may surprise you.
Tomatoes are rich in lycopene, a powerful antioxidant known for protecting the heart. After one year of daily consumption, many individuals see:
Lower LDL cholesterol
Reduced blood pressure
Improved blood vessel flexibility
A study from Finland found that people with higher lycopene levels had up to 50% lower risk of heart disease.

Dermatologists note that lycopene acts as a natural “internal sunscreen.”
Eating tomatoes every day for a year has been linked to:
Smoother, brighter skin
Fewer wrinkles
Better moisture retention
Reduced skin damage from UV rays
Participants in a UK study who consumed tomato paste daily had 33% more protection against sunburn.

Tomatoes contain fiber and natural acids that support the digestive system.
After one year, many people report:
Reduced constipation
Better gut motility
Improved appetite
Healthier gut microbiome
The combination of fiber and antioxidants helps maintain a cleaner, more efficient digestive tract.
With their high levels of vitamin A, lutein, and beta-carotene, tomatoes support long-term vision.
Eating them daily can help:
Reduce dry eyes
Slow age-related macular degeneration
Improve night vision
This cumulative effect becomes more noticeable after consistent intake.
Lycopene has been extensively studied for its role in cancer prevention.
After one year of steady consumption, the body achieves higher lycopene stores, which may help lower the risk of:
Prostate cancer
Breast cancer
Lung cancer
Stomach cancer
Tomatoes are one of the richest natural sources of dietary lycopene, especially when cooked.
Tomatoes are low in calories but rich in water and fiber.
Eating them daily may help:
Reduce cravings
Improve metabolism
Lower overall calorie intake
Support healthy weight maintenance
This makes tomatoes a simple addition for those trying to manage weight naturally.
Chronic inflammation is a hidden cause of many diseases.
After one year of tomato-rich eating, inflammatory markers — such as CRP (C-reactive protein) — tend to decrease.
People often report:
Less joint pain
Increased energy
Improved immunity
Eating tomatoes every day for a year isn’t just a small dietary habit — it’s a long-term investment in better health. From heart protection and glowing skin to cancer prevention and stronger eyesight, the benefits become clearer and more measurable over time.
A simple tomato each day may truly be one of the easiest ways to boost long-term wellness.
